服务器如何修改路由ip
-
要修改服务器的路由IP,需要按照以下步骤进行操作:
-
登录服务器:首先,使用合法的用户名和密码登录服务器。可以使用SSH客户端,如PuTTY进行远程登录,或者直接在服务器终端登录。
-
查看当前路由设置:使用以下命令查看当前服务器的路由设置:
route -n这将显示当前服务器的路由表,包括目的网络、网关和接口等信息。
-
修改路由设置:如果要修改服务器的路由IP,可以使用以下命令进行修改:
sudo route add default gw <gateway> dev <interface>其中,
<gateway>是新的默认网关的IP地址,<interface>是网络接口的名称,如eth0或ens33等。 -
永久保存路由设置(可选):如果希望修改的路由设置在服务器重启后仍然有效,可以将修改过的路由设置永久保存。具体操作方法因操作系统而异,以下是几种常见的操作系统的保存方法:
- CentOS/RHEL:编辑
/etc/sysconfig/network-scripts/route-<interface>文件,添加新的路由设置,并保存文件。 - Ubuntu/Debian:编辑
/etc/network/interfaces文件,添加新的路由设置,并保存文件。 - Windows Server:使用
route add命令添加路由设置,并使用netsh命令将路由设置保存到注册表。
- CentOS/RHEL:编辑
-
测试新路由设置:使用以下命令测试新的路由设置是否生效:
ping <destination>其中,
<destination>是一个已知的可达IP地址,用于检查新的路由设置是否正确。
注意事项:
- 修改服务器的路由IP需要在具有管理员权限的账户下进行。
- 确保正确输入新的默认网关和网络接口名称。
- 修改路由设置可能会影响服务器的网络连接,请谨慎操作,并备份重要数据。
- 保存路由设置的方法因操作系统而异,请根据服务器的操作系统选择适合的方法。
1年前 -
-
服务器修改路由IP的过程包括以下步骤:
-
连接服务器:首先,通过SSH(Secure Shell)协议或其他远程连接方式连接到要修改路由IP的服务器。确保具有管理员权限的访问权限。
-
查看当前路由设置:使用适当的命令(如
ip route show、route -n等)查看当前服务器的路由设置。这将显示服务器当前配置的路由表。 -
编辑网络配置文件:根据服务器的操作系统,找到相应的网络配置文件进行编辑。常用的网络配置文件包括
/etc/network/interfaces(Ubuntu/Debian)、/etc/sysconfig/network-scripts/ifcfg-xxx(CentOS/Red Hat)等。 -
修改路由设置:根据需要修改路由配置。具体的修改内容可能取决于服务器的网络拓扑和要实现的路由策略。可以添加、删除或修改路由项,包括目标网络、网关、子网掩码等选项。
-
保存修改并重启网络服务:保存对网络配置文件的修改,并重启网络服务以使修改生效。具体的命令可以是
service networking restart(Ubuntu/Debian)、service network restart(CentOS/Red Hat)等。
需要注意的是,修改服务器的路由IP可能会导致与其他网络设备的连接中断或网络中断。在进行修改之前,最好备份当前的网络配置文件,以防止出现问题。
此外,还可以使用网络管理工具或图形界面工具来修改服务器的路由IP,这取决于服务器所使用的操作系统和网络管理工具的可用性。
1年前 -
-
服务器修改路由IP的操作流程如下:
-
连接到服务器:
在开始之前,需要通过SSH(Secure Shell)或者其他远程连接工具连接到你的服务器。确保你具有管理员权限或root访问权限,以便能够修改网络配置。 -
查看当前网络配置:
使用以下命令查看当前服务器的网络配置:
$ ifconfig在命令输出中,你会看到网卡接口(如eth0、eth1等)以及与之关联的IP地址和其他网络配置信息。
-
找到要修改的网卡接口:
根据需要修改的IP地址所在的网络接口,找到你要修改的网卡接口。通常网卡接口的命名约定为eth0或者enp0sX(X代表数字)。 -
备份网络配置文件:
在进行任何修改之前,建议先备份服务器的网络配置文件以防止出错。一般情况下,网络配置文件位于/etc/network/interfaces或者/etc/sysconfig/network-scripts/目录下。你可以使用以下命令备份文件到一个安全的位置:
$ sudo cp /etc/network/interfaces /etc/network/interfaces.bak- 编辑网络配置文件:
使用编辑器(如vi或nano)打开你的网络配置文件。根据你使用的操作系统,可能有不同的网络配置文件。请根据你的情况进行操作。
对于Debian/Ubuntu系统,编辑
/etc/network/interfaces文件:$ sudo vi /etc/network/interfaces对于CentOS/Fedora系统,编辑
/etc/sysconfig/network-scripts/ifcfg-<interface>文件,其中<interface>是你要修改的网卡接口名称。$ sudo vi /etc/sysconfig/network-scripts/ifcfg-<interface>- 修改IP地址:
在打开的文件中,找到与你要修改的IP地址相关的配置项。通常你会看到类似以下的内容:
iface <interface> inet static address <current_ip_address> netmask <current_subnet_mask> gateway <current_gateway_address>将
<current_ip_address>、<current_subnet_mask>和<current_gateway_address>分别替换为你想要修改的IP地址、子网掩码和网关地址。-
保存并关闭文件:
在编辑完文件后,保存并关闭它。 -
重新启动网络服务:
使用以下命令重新启动网络服务以应用新的配置:
$ sudo systemctl restart networking根据你的操作系统,可能使用的是
service命令而不是systemctl命令。- 验证新的IP地址:
使用以下命令验证新的IP地址是否已成功配置:
$ ifconfig确认输出中显示的IP地址是你刚刚修改的新IP地址。
通过上述步骤,你就可以修改服务器的路由IP地址了。请确保在修改网络配置文件之前做好备份,以防出现配置错误导致服务器无法正常连接网络的情况。
1年前 -